Choosing the Right Gym Mat: Your Guide to a Better Workout
Getting a good gym mat makes a big difference. It protects you and your floor. This guide helps you pick the best one. We’ll cover what to look for, what they’re made of, and how to use them.
Key Features to Look For
Thickness is Important
Thickness is a big deal. Thicker mats offer more cushioning. This is great for hard exercises like yoga or sit-ups. A thinner mat might be better for quick workouts where you don’t need much padding.
Size Matters
Think about how you’ll use the mat. Do you need space to stretch out? Or just enough room for your feet? Make sure the mat is long and wide enough for your activities.
Grip and Stability
You don’t want to slip! Good mats have a non-slip surface. This keeps you steady during tough moves. It also helps protect your floor from scratches.
Durability
A good mat lasts a long time. Look for strong materials that won’t tear easily. This means you won’t have to buy a new one too often.
Important Materials
Foam is Popular
Many gym mats use foam. Different types of foam offer different feelings. High-density foam is firm and supportive. Softer foam gives more cushion.
PVC is Tough
PVC is a strong plastic. Mats made of PVC are usually very durable. They resist wear and tear well. They can also be easy to clean.
TPE is Eco-Friendly
TPE is a newer material. It’s often considered more eco-friendly. TPE mats are usually lightweight. They also offer good grip and cushion.
Factors That Affect Quality
Construction Quality
How the mat is put together matters. Good seams and strong bonding make a mat last longer. Cheaply made mats might fall apart quickly.
Density of the Material
A denser material means the mat is more compact. Denser mats offer better support. They also tend to be more durable than less dense options.
Surface Texture
A mat with a good texture provides better grip. This prevents slipping. A smooth surface might feel nice but can be dangerous. Textures can also make the mat more comfortable.
User Experience and Use Cases
Home Workouts
Gym mats are perfect for home gyms. They protect your floors from equipment. They also give you a comfortable space to exercise. You can do yoga, strength training, or cardio on them.
Yoga and Pilates
For yoga and pilates, a mat with good grip is a must. It needs to be soft enough for comfort but firm enough for balance. Thickness helps with joint protection.
Kids’ Play Areas
You can use gym mats to create a safe play area for kids. They cushion falls and make the floor softer for playing. This is great for busy toddlers.
Outdoor Activities
Some mats are good for outdoor use. They protect you from rough ground. They also make sitting or lying down more comfortable. Make sure the mat can handle different weather.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What is the best thickness for a gym mat?
A: The best thickness depends on your workout. For yoga, 1/4 inch is common. For more intense training, 1/2 inch or more provides better cushioning.
Q: Are PVC gym mats safe?
A: Most PVC mats are safe. However, some people are sensitive to the smell of PVC. Look for PVC-free options if you have concerns.
Q: How do I clean my gym mat?
A: Most mats can be cleaned with mild soap and water. Always check the manufacturer’s instructions. Some mats can be wiped down easily.
Q: Can I use a gym mat on carpet?
A: Yes, you can. A mat adds stability on carpet. It also prevents the mat from sliding around.
Q: What’s the difference between a yoga mat and a general gym mat?
A: Yoga mats are usually thinner and focus on grip. General gym mats can be thicker for more cushioning and are often larger.
Q: Will a gym mat protect my floor from heavy weights?
A: A thick, dense gym mat can offer some protection. For very heavy weights, you might need a specialized weightlifting mat.
Q: How long do gym mats usually last?
A: With good care, a gym mat can last for several years. Heavy use and improper cleaning can shorten its lifespan.
Q: Are there eco-friendly gym mat options?
A: Yes, TPE and natural rubber are good eco-friendly choices. Many brands offer sustainable options.
Q: Can I use a gym mat outdoors?
A: Some mats are designed for outdoor use. Check if the material is weather-resistant. Avoid leaving them out in direct sun for too long.
Q: What should I do if my mat smells bad?
A: Air it out in a well-ventilated area. You can also try cleaning it with a gentle solution. Some smells fade with time.
